Gate 是一款非常受欢迎的数据科学和自然语言处理(NLP)工具,它提供了大量的API和组件来帮助研究人员和开发者处理文本数据、构建复杂的NLP管道等。Gate 可以通过多种方式获取,包括源码的直接编译或使用预构建的二进制文件。以下是如何下载并安装Gate的基本指南。
官方网站下载
1. **访问官方网站**:首先,你需要前往Gate的官方网站:http://gate.ac.uk/。
2. **选择版本**:在官网,你可以找到不同版本的发布信息。通常情况下,推荐使用最新稳定版以获取最新的功能和修复的安全问题。
3. **下载安装包**: 根据你的操作系统(Windows, macOS 或 Linux)选择合适的下载链接。Gate提供两种主要形式的软件包:一种是GUI形式的Java应用程序,另一种是命令行版本的API包。
使用pip安装
对于Python开发者来说,可以通过Python的包管理器`pip`来快速获取Gate的部分功能。这将允许你在Python脚本中调用一些NLP相关的方法而不必完全下载整个软件包。
```sh
pip install gatepy
```
注意:这种方式提供的功能有限,更多高级特性需要通过官方渠道获得完整的安装包。
安装步骤
下载完成后,按照以下步骤进行安装:
1. 对于Windows用户,通常提供的是.exe文件,双击运行即可跟随向导完成安装。
2. macOS和Linux平台下,Gate一般以.tar.gz格式提供。首先解压:
```sh
tar -xvzf gate-*.tar.gz
```
3. 进入到解压后的目录:
```sh
cd gate-*
```
4. 启动Gate(在命令行中):
```sh
./run.bat # Windows环境下使用该命令
sh run.sh # macOS或Linux环境下使用该命令
```
通过以上步骤,你应该能够成功下载并安装Gate。如果遇到任何问题,请参考官方文档或者社区论坛来寻求帮助。
总结
Gate是一个强大的文本处理工具,无论你是做数据科学还是自然语言处理的研究人员,它都能提供丰富的功能支持。根据你的需求和操作系统,选择合适的获取方式,并按照上述步骤完成安装即可开始使用了。